Overview
SMBJ6.5CAHM3_A/I from Vishay General Semiconductor is a bidirectional surface-mount transient voltage suppressor (TVS) diode in SMB (DO-214AA) package, designed to protect sensitive electronics against voltage transients induced by inductive load switching and lightning surges. It features a 6.5 V stand-off voltage (VWM), 7.22–7.98 V breakdown voltage (VBR) at 10 mA, 600 W peak pulse power (10/1000 µs), clamping voltage of 11.2 V at 53.6 A, and operates across –55 °C to +150 °C junction temperature.
For engineers reviewing the SMBJ6.5CAHM3_A/I datasheet, SMBJ6.5CAHM3_A/I pinout, SMBJ6.5CAHM3_A/I application, or SMBJ6.5CAHM3_A/I equivalent, this device is selected for robust overvoltage protection on DC power rails, bidirectional signal lines, and automotive-grade sensor interfaces where low clamping voltage, fast response (<1 ns), and AEC-Q101 qualification are critical design requirements.
Technical Context
This bidirectional TVS diode uses a glass-passivated silicon junction to achieve low incremental surge resistance and excellent clamping performance under repetitive 10/1000 µs transients. Its symmetrical I-V characteristics enable identical protection in both polarities without polarity marking on the case.
The device is rated for 600 W peak pulse power with 0.01 % duty cycle, derated linearly above 25 °C ambient per Fig. 2, and exhibits a typical thermal resistance of 100 °C/W (junction-to-ambient) on standard 0.2" × 0.2" copper pads - enabling reliable operation in compact industrial and automotive PCB layouts.

How does the bidirectional configuration of SMBJ6.5CAHM3_A/I affect its circuit placement?
The SMBJ6.5CAHM3_A/I has no polarity marking and functions identically in both directions, allowing placement across any two points requiring symmetrical overvoltage protection - such as differential signal lines, AC-coupled interfaces, or ungrounded power rails. Unlike unidirectional variants, the SMBJ6.5CAHM3_A/I eliminates orientation errors during automated assembly and avoids the need for dual-diode configurations in floating systems.
What is the thermal resistance of SMBJ6.5CAHM3_A/I, and how does it impact PCB layout?
The SMBJ6.5CAHM3_A/I has a typical junction-to-ambient thermal resistance (RθJA) of 100 °C/W when mounted on 0.2" × 0.2" (5.0 mm × 5.0 mm) copper pads per terminal. This value assumes minimum recommended pad layout per datasheet Figure 5. To maintain safe junction temperatures under sustained surge duty, designers must allocate adequate copper area and avoid excessive trace length between the SMBJ6.5CAHM3_A/I and ground/power planes.
